Great gaming unit!

Way too much fun! Setup takes a little time, but it is easy to do, especially if you already have an MSN Live Account or Hotmail Account. You do want to make sure you have plenty of space to play. If you get too close, Kinect can't "see" you anymore, so you'll want to stay about 6ft in front of the controller. Really surprises me how well the voice commands work, but sometimes the music from your game will drown out your voice, so I usually have the TV controller handy so I can hit the mute button. Also, it is possible to turn off the console with Kinect. I've read lots of posts online that say it cannot be done, but it can be. Just go to the main menu and scroll over to the Settings page. There is a menu selection that says Turn Off. When you are on this page, simply say, "XBox, turn off." Xbox will then ask you if you want to turn off the console. At that point, say "Yes", and the console is turned off. Some people would like to use Kinect to turn on XBox, but that would mean it would have to be more in a sleep mode than completely powered off. Considering that the Kinect has a video camera in it, I would find that tremendously creepy, especially if someone could hack into it. (It is connected to the Internet.) Besides, it's not that big of a deal to turn on the XBox. You just touch the big round X on the console, or press the big round X on the controller for a second or two. It does take about 30 seconds for Kinect to come online after you turn on the console. A little green light on Kinect blinks and goes steady once it is ready to go. Kinect will move up and down as it tries to "find" you, so don't freak out about that. Simply wave at Kinect, and if you have set up Kinect ID, face Kinect and it will sign you in.
